The study … WebCompensation is more than just straight salary. The IRS considers “compensation” to include the total of all “income” received by the CEO, which includes, for example: contributions to retirement accounts, housing and car allowances, as well as insurance premiums paid by the nonprofit to benefit the executive director, and even club ... breakfast in oxford nc
